David Fincher’s The Killer: An Exciting Film Classic

Source: Netflix

Our best new movies to stream is The Killer, a nail biter from the renowned David Fincher. The film depicts Michael Fassbender’s character, a cold blooded hired killer, as he struggles to keep his cool after a mission goes horribly wrong. Showing his range as an actor, Fassbender gives a mesmerizing performance. The Killer is undeniably a top 2024 Netflix original film because to Fincher’s expert directing and a finely plotted script.

Tom Cruise’s Dynamic Born on the Fourth of July Performance

Photo: EVERETT COLLECTION

Born on the Fourth of July is a moving military drama that delves into the Vietnam military’s aftermath from the perspective of young soldier Ron Kovic, portrayed superbly by Tom Cruise. The film’s director, Oliver Stone, brings attention to the human toll of war and the difficulties returned service members encounter via his realistic and grim narrative style. In a performance that showcases his breadth as an actor, Cruise gives a career defining turn. One of the top movies on Netflix, this moving picture is an absolute must watch.

Devil in a Blue Dress: A Neo Noir Gem

Source: Criterion Collection

Among Netflix’s offerings, Devil in a Blue Dress stands out as a hidden treasure for vintage noir film enthusiasts. The story takes place in 1940s Los Angeles and follows Denzel Washington’s character, Private Detective Easy Rawlins, as he becomes entangled in a perilous case about a lady who goes missing. Thanks to his stunning cinematography and riveting story, director Carl Franklin brilliantly embodies the noir genre. With Washington’s magnetic performance elevating an already captivating plot, Devil in a Blue Dress becomes one of the Best Movies on Netflix.

Glengarry Glen Ross: A Stellar Ensemble Cast

Glengarry Glen Ross has an outstanding ensemble cast that includes Jack Lemmon, Alec Baldwin, and Al Pacino, making it a powerful drama. Exploring themes of desperation, ambition, and morality, the film dives into the ruthless world of real estate marketers, based on David Mamet’s Pulitzer Prize–winning play. Everyone who loves strong narrative and brilliant acting should watch Glengarry Glen Ross because of the dramatic performances and incisive conversation. Don’t miss it; it’s certainly one of Netflix’s finest films.

L.A. Confidential: A Neo Noir Classic

Source: Flickeringmyth

L.A. Confidential is a masterwork of neo noir cinema that immerses audiences in the sordid side of Los Angeles in the 1950s. Kevin Spacey, Russell Crowe, and Guy Pearce star as three police officers who, while investigating a string of killings, stumble into departmental corruption and treachery, based on a book by James Ellroy. With breathtaking photography and an enthralling story, director Curtis Hanson does an excellent job of capturing the era’s vibe. Without a question, L.A. Confidential is the finest film available on Netflix and an absolute must watch for noir movie buffs.

Moneyball: A Smart and Engaging Sports Drama

The sports drama Moneyball takes the underdog narrative to a new level. The film, which is based on Michael Lewis’s book, follows Brad Pitt’s character, Billy Beane, as he uses statistical analysis to try to develop a baseball club on a tight budget for the Oakland Athletics. Moneyball provides an intriguing glimpse into the world of sports business, thanks to its clever narrative and superb performances by Pitt and Jonah Hill. It’s one of the top new movies on Netflix because it’s intelligent and entertaining, so anybody can watch it, not just sports lovers.

The Power of the Dog: Jane Campion’s Masterful Western

By Christy Griffin Netflix

Famous filmmaker Jane Campion’s The Power of the Dog is a breathtaking western drama. In this cinematic adaptation of the book by Thomas Savage, Benedict Cumberbatch plays the role of a cruel rancher who harasses Kirsten Dunst’s character and her kid, who are his brother’s new bride and wife. The Power of the Dog is an expertly crafted picture that captivates audiences with its stunning visuals, stirring performances, and a plot that builds to a devastating end. In addition to being one of the Movies on netflix of all time, it is also one of the finest Netflix originals.

Whiplash: An Electrifying Music Drama

Source: IndieWire

Whiplash is a riveting and emotional musical drama that follows Miles Teller’s character, a teenage drummer, as he learns the ropes from J.K. Simmons’s character, a cruel and violent music teacher. Watching Whiplash is like being on the edge of your seat due to the thrilling performances, heart pounding drumming scenes, and well crafted narrative. Teller is convincing as the driven young musician, while Simmons gives an Oscar winning performance as the scary teacher. You should not miss it since it is one of the Movies on netflix.
